补充资料:介形纲
介形纲
Ostracda

   甲壳动物亚门的一纲。为具双甲壳的水生无脊椎动物  。身体很小,体长一般不超过0.5毫米,最大达23毫米。头胸甲由两瓣介壳构成,整个身体完全包被在壳瓣内,壳瓣主要为钙镁质或几丁质,两性异形。左、右两壳瓣等大或不等大,大壳常沿边缘包覆小壳。壳体侧视卵形、肾形、长方形、三角形等;壳面光滑,或网纹、具沟、隆起、脊、瘤、眼结节、卵育囊等;有些种类前端或前腹部具喙及凹痕。铰合构造无齿,或具各类型齿。身体分节不明显,末部向腹面弯曲,末端具尾叉。形状随种而异。附肢最多不超过7对。多数无鳃,少数具片状鳃。肛门多数开于尾叉背面。多数具单眼。雌雄异体。多数种类雌性的卵产出后藏于身体背面两壳之间,有的直接散布在水中。
   介形类在海洋中从沿岸到4000米深海底都有发现。在淡水的河川、湖泊以及高山湖泊都有分布。多数种为底栖  ,少数营浮游生活,介形类可作为一些经济鱼类一定时期的主要食料。介形类有许多化石种类,其个体甚小,容易在钻井岩芯中找到,在寻找矿产资源(石油、煤、地下水等)时  ,是确定地层时代和沉积环境的重要和微体化石之一。对于指示海底石油资源的勘探和地质年代的确定,以及海洋古生态的研究都具有重要意义。
   根据最近分类,将该纲分为3个亚纲。共5目54科约5600多种。
